'Tejashwi cannot lead the party like Lalu Yadav', says Ashok Sinha who quit RJD

Tejashwi was handed over the reins of the party after Lalu was convicted in second and third fodder scam cases.

Cracks have begun to appear in the RJD days after former Bihar chief minister Lalu Prasad Yadav was jailed in connection with the fodder scam case. RJD general secretary Ashok Sinha on Tuesday resigned from his post and quit the party.

He said that the RJD had become irrelevant and that Lalu's son Tejashwi Yadav was not capable of leading the party.

Ashok Sinha

"RJD has become irrelevant in today's times, better to leave party respectfully than to waste time here. Tejashwi Yadav cannot lead the party like Lalu Ji did," Sinha told news agency ANI.

Tejashwi was handed over the reins of the party after Lalu was convicted in second and third fodder scam cases. Lalu Yadav is staring at a cummulative jail term of 13.5 years in the three cases of fodder scam.

Biggest challenge for Tejashwi is to handle the inernal rift conflictrs within the party. There are apprehensions that Tejashwi may not be able to hold the flock together as he does not have same stature within the party as his father.
